Model: Archer AX50  
Hardware Version: V1
Firmware Version: 1.0.11 Build 20210730 rel.54485

I bought this router few months back and since beginning this device is giving me troubles.

 

I am experiencing frequent wifi dropouts both on 2.4 ghz and 5 ghz networks. Have tried multiple combinations of wifi settings but the problem is not getting solved. Can anybody help me with the solution plz?

Re:Archer AX50 frequent wifi disconnections
2021-11-30 06:54:33

@Nishankg I'd recommend resetting the router to factory settings. If that doesn't help, check if router is hot when Wi-Fi drops out. AX50 is know for having issues with heat so there could be thermal throttling.

Re:Archer AX50 frequent wifi disconnections
2021-12-02 13:02:53

@Nishankg try switching transmit power to medium or low ... had same problems and this helped me ... but also please contact TP-Link support as this looks like a design flaw and they need to be spammed otherwise they will not do anything about it

Re:Archer AX50 frequent wifi disconnections
2021-12-02 15:56:07

@Nishankg also position your router so there is some air flow underneath ... i suspect this problem is a result of excessive overheating ... put it on PET bottle caps for example
